Создание Minecraft на Python — пошаговая инструкция для новичков

Мечтаешь создать свой авторский мир в Minecraft? Хочешь научиться программированию на Python и получить эти навыки сразу применить в игре? У нас есть для тебя отличная новость!

Мы представляем пошаговую инструкцию, которая поможет тебе создать собственный Minecraft мир, используя язык программирования Python.

В этом увлекательном проекте ты сможешь:

  • Оживить своего игрового персонажа, добавить новые интерактивные возможности и создать уникальную историю в Minecraft.
  • Разработать свой собственный виртуальный мир с уникальными правилами и заданиями для других игроков.
  • Изучить основы программирования на Python и применить их на практике в игровой среде.

Ты сможешь не только играть в Minecraft, но и активно участвовать в его создании!

Не теряй времени зря! Присоединяйся к нашему проекту и начни свое увлекательное путешествие в мир программирования и Minecraft прямо сейчас.

Узнаем, как создать Minecraft на Python

Создание Minecraft на Python дает возможность расширить функционал игры, изменить графику, добавить новые блоки, создать свои модификации и многое другое. Все это можно сделать при помощи программирования на языке Python и использования специальных библиотек, таких как Pygame.

Для начала вам потребуется установить Python на свой компьютер. Это можно сделать, скачав его с официального сайта python.org. Далее необходимо установить Pygame — библиотеку, которая позволяет работать с графикой и звуком в Python. Pygame также доступен для скачивания с официального сайта pygame.org.

После установки всех необходимых инструментов можно начать создавать свой Minecraft на Python. С помощью Pygame вы можете реализовать отображение блоков, управление персонажем, генерацию мира и многое другое. Можно вдохнуть жизнь в ваш мир, добавив звуковые эффекты и создав уникальные особенности игровых блоков.

Важно помнить, что создание Minecraft на Python требует знания языка программирования и понимания основных концепций игрового разработчика. Будьте готовы к тому, что этот процесс может занять некоторое время и потребует от вас терпения и настойчивости.

Однако, с помощью доступных ресурсов в Интернете, таких как обучающие видео, учебники и форумы, вы сможете освоить Python и создать свою собственную версию Minecraft. Помимо того, что это будет интересным и творческим проектом, вы также приобретете ценные навыки программирования.

Не ждите больше, начните учить Python и создавайте свой собственный Minecraft прямо сейчас!

Шаг 1: Подготовка к созданию игры

Прежде чем начать создание собственного Minecraft на Python, необходимо выполнить несколько подготовительных шагов.

Шаг 1.1: Установка Python

Первым делом, убедитесь, что у вас установлен Python на вашем компьютере. Это язык программирования, на котором будет написана игра. Вы можете скачать и установить Python с официального сайта разработчиков.

Для успешной установки следуйте инструкциям на экране и выберите версию Python, подходящую вашей операционной системе.

Шаг 1.2: Установка библиотеки Pygame

Pygame — это библиотека, которая позволяет создавать игры на языке Python. Для работы над нашим проектом необходимо установить Pygame.

Чтобы установить Pygame, откройте командную строку и введите следующую команду:

pip install pygame

После выполнения этой команды Pygame будет установлен на вашем компьютере.

Шаг 1.3: Настройка IDE

Выберите удобную для вас интегрированную среду разработки (IDE), в которой будете создавать игру. Благодаря IDE вы сможете легко и удобно редактировать и запускать код.

Некоторые популярные IDE для Python:

  • PyCharm
  • Visual Studio Code
  • Spyder

Выберите IDE, установите ее и настройте, чтобы она работала с Python.

Поздравляем! Теперь вы готовы к созданию своего собственного Minecraft на Python.

Выбор необходимого программного обеспечения

Для того чтобы начать создавать Minecraft на Python, вам понадобится несколько инструментов и программного обеспечения.

1. Python: Основным языком программирования, который вы будете использовать, будет Python. Убедитесь, что у вас установлена последняя версия Python. Вы можете скачать его с официального сайта https://www.python.org/downloads/.

2. Редактор кода: Для написания кода вам понадобится хороший редактор кода. Вы можете использовать любой удобный вам редактор, такой как Visual Studio Code, PyCharm или Sublime Text.

3. Minecraft Forge: Чтобы создавать моды для Minecraft, вам потребуется установить Minecraft Forge. Forge — это инструмент, который поможет вам взаимодействовать с кодом Minecraft и добавлять новые функции. Вы можете скачать Minecraft Forge с официального сайта https://files.minecraftforge.net/.

4. Библиотеки для работы с Minecraft: Для более удобной работы с Minecraft вам понадобятся специальные библиотеки, такие как pyglet или minecraft-api. Установите их с помощью менеджера пакетов Python или pip.

После установки всех необходимых инструментов и программного обеспечения вы будете готовы приступить к созданию своего собственного Minecraft на Python. Удачи!

Установка и настройка Python и Pygame

Шаг 1: Зайдите на официальный сайт Python и скачайте последнюю версию Python для вашей операционной системы.

Шаг 2: Запустите установщик Python и следуйте инструкциям. Убедитесь, что выбрана опция «Добавить Python в PATH».

Шаг 3: Проверьте успешную установку Python, открыв командную строку и вводя команду «python —version». Вы должны увидеть версию установленного Python.

Шаг 4: Установите библиотеку Pygame, введя команду «pip install pygame» в командной строке.

Шаг 5: Проверьте успешную установку Pygame, введя команду «python» в командной строке и введя следующий код:

import pygame

print(pygame.ver)

Шаг 6: Если вы видите версию Pygame, значит установка прошла успешно и вы готовы начать создавать Minecraft на Python с помощью Pygame!

Шаг 2: Создание основных элементов игры

В этом разделе мы научимся создавать основные элементы игры Minecraft на Python.

1. Создайте игровое поле.

Для начала определите размер игрового поля, например, 10 на 10 клеток. Создайте двумерный список, который будет представлять игровое поле. Каждая клетка может быть либо пустой, либо содержать элемент (например, блок земли).

2. Определите персонажа игрока.

Создайте объект, который будет представлять игрока. Задайте его начальные координаты на игровом поле и определите направление, в котором он будет двигаться.

3. Реализуйте управление персонажем.

Добавьте логику для управления персонажем. Например, игрок может перемещаться вверх, вниз, влево и вправо по игровому полю. При перемещении, проверяйте, что игрок не выходит за границы игрового поля и не пересекается с другими элементами.

4. Добавьте взаимодействие с элементами игрового поля.

Реализуйте логику взаимодействия персонажа с элементами игрового поля. Например, игрок может разрушать блоки или собирать ресурсы.

5. Добавьте визуальное представление игры.

Чтобы игра была более интерактивной, можно добавить визуальное представление игры. Например, можно отображать игровое поле и персонажа на графическом окне, а также анимировать перемещение персонажа.

Это все основные шаги для создания Minecraft на Python. В следующем разделе мы продолжим создание игры и добавим еще несколько возможностей.

Создание окна игры

Сначала нам понадобится установить библиотеку pygame. Для этого откройте терминал и введите следующую команду:

pip install pygame

После успешной установки библиотеки pygame, создайте новый файл с расширением .py и откройте его в вашей любимой среде разработки.

Далее, импортируйте библиотеку pygame в вашем файле:

import pygame

Теперь мы можем создать окно игры. Для этого определите размеры окна, например, 800 на 600 пикселей:

WIDTH = 800

HEIGHT = 600

Затем создайте окно игры с заданными размерами:

window = pygame.display.set_mode((WIDTH, HEIGHT))

Далее, установите заголовок окна:

pygame.display.set_caption(«Minecraft на Python»)

Теперь мы можем запустить игровой цикл, в котором будет происходить отрисовка и обновление окна игры:

running = True

while running:

    # обработка событий

    for event in pygame.event.get():

        if event.type == pygame.QUIT:

            running = False

        # обновление состояния игры

    # отрисовка игровых объектов

Вот и все! Теперь у вас есть базовый шаблон для создания окна игры в Minecraft на Python. В следующих разделах мы будем добавлять игровые объекты и логику игры. Следуйте инструкциям, и вскоре вы создадите свой собственный Minecraft на Python!

Добавление главного персонажа

Для начала создадим изображение главного персонажа. Мы можем использовать спрайты из оригинальной игры или создать свой уникальный дизайн персонажа.

Затем мы должны добавить изображение персонажа на игровую сцену. Для этого создадим новый объект, который будет представлять персонажа, и зададим его координаты в начальной точке карты.

Теперь нам нужно научить персонажа реагировать на действия игрока. Например, мы можем добавить код, который позволит персонажу перемещаться по карте при нажатии на определенные клавиши. Мы также можем добавить анимацию движения персонажа, чтобы игра выглядела еще более реалистично.

Наконец, добавим возможность взаимодействия персонажа с окружающими объектами. Например, мы можем сделать так, чтобы персонаж мог собирать ресурсы или строить различные предметы.

Главный персонаж — это ключевой элемент любой игры. Он добавляет интерактивность и создает уникальный геймплей. Следуя нашей пошаговой инструкции, вы сможете создать главного персонажа в своей игре на Python и увлекательно проводить время, играя в свой собственный вариант Minecraft!

Оцените статью